📣 Conseils aux voyageurs
The United States offers diverse travel experiences, including major urban centers (e.g., Manhattan, Chicago), natural sites (e.g., Yellowstone, Alaska, Southwest canyonlands), and coastal regions (e.g., Florida, Hawaii, Pacific Northwest).
- Most non-retail businesses close on federal holidays, though private business hours may vary.
- If a federal holiday falls on a weekend, observances often occur on the nearest weekday.
- The period between Thanksgiving and January 1 is the 'holiday season,' which can cause significant crowds and congestion in travel hubs and retail locations.
- Key federal holidays include New Year's Day (January 1).
- Dining etiquette is generally European-influenced; avoid joining occupied tables and keep noise levels low. When visiting a private home, it is customary to bring a small, non-cash gift for the host. To take leftovers, ask the server for 'to go' containers.
À propos de ce jour férié
The term 'Native Americans' is a broad, non-enumerated term referring to Indigenous peoples of the United States. The U.S. Census Bureau tracks 'American Indians and Alaska Natives' based on tribal affiliation and origins in North or South America.
